Captain’s Noon Reports – Belle Amie – 2023-07-18

Anchor at Punta Herradura, Bahía de los Angeles, Winds: N  0-2 knots, no gust, Seas: NW calm.

Yesterday we found a pod of common dolphins while we were sailing to Bahia de los Angeles, we found them  5 miles to the E of Isla San Marcos. After an hour with them, we picked up the skiff and we continued sailing to Bahia. We arrived in Bahia at 0820 of today, the local Pangas arrived on time, by 0910 we got all guests in the adventure, and at 0928 we got the 1st whale shark!

Our guests enjoyed this 1st session, we encountered around 5 of them and some dolphins. By midday, all pangas came back and our guests enjoyed lunch. We are preparing everything for the next Session, our guests are very excited for the next session. The plan is to spend the Taco night here at anchor and then depart to San Pedro Martir.
